Grundfos Wins Global Innovation Award

Frost & Sullivan have acknowledged Grundfos’s work to deliver pioneering, sustainable water solutions to a world where millions still lack access to safe water. The company has been presented with 2019’s award for best practices in Emerging Market Innovation in sustainable water solutions.
The global research company praised Grundfos for addressing water challenges in emerging markets by introducing solar-powered water pumps that are straightforward to install while also innovating new business models that make pumps available in a more affordable way.
Grundfos works with local partners to deliver on its commitment to the U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) 6 and 13. After the initial installation process, Grundfos recruits and trains local technicians on the operation and maintenance of the pump systems, thereby creating local expertise.
According to Frost & Sullivan, Grundfos gives customers across the globe better access to sustainable water pump systems supported by innovative, reliable technology and expert service, including solar-powered water pumps and the Lifelink product line.
